Half Moon Run offer their album Sun Leads Me On this week, following 2012’s Dark Eyes, with a return from the piano playing Vanessa Carlton too. The single sides of things are headed by new music from feel-good band Clean Cut Kid, and a new Sigma collaboration.

Chilled out Canadian indie group, Half Moon Run, will release their second album, Sun Leads Me On,  this week. With comparisons made to Foals, this new release could be very successful. Their track ‘Trust’ which is to be on the new album, is edgy , upbeat, electronic and ambient.  Out Via Glassnote Records.

You may know Vanessa Carlton’s one hit wonder, ‘A Thousand Miles’ which shot to fame in the early 00’s. Liberman is Carlton’s fifth studio album, named after her great grandfather. With a slightly new sound, could Carlton rise to fame once more? Out Via Dine Alone Records.

Mischievous teen heartthrobs, 5 Seconds of Summer are set to release their second studio album, Sounds Good Feels Good. Their huge single ‘She’s Kinda Hot’ has been met with predictions that the band could be the next big thing in pop-punk, especially since the track was co-written by Good Charlotte’s Madden brothers.  Out Via Capitol Records.

‘Runaway’ follows the release of Clean Cut Kid’s infectious track ‘Vitamin C’. The Liverpool quartet’s latest offering springs into action with a racing beat, combining the husband and wife’s vocals that beautifully offset each other. Perhaps not as catchy as ‘Vitamin C’, but give it time. Out via Polydor.

Droning, distorted vocals introduce listeners to ‘Pears For Lunch’ by Girl Band. Stemming from their debut album Holding Hands With Jamie, the track repeats “I don’t know what she wants” as it becomes desperate and raw. A little bit jarring, but nonetheless an interesting listen. Out via Rough Trade.

Sigma are back again this week, this time collaborating with Diztortion and Jacob Banks for ‘Redemption’. The track is fuelled by the soulful vocals of Jacob Banks, with the statement Sigma racing tempo, with soaring climaxes. Out via 3 Beat Productions.
